Abstract

Seasonal Influenza continues to present a significant annual burden as the vaccination rate for all persons six months and older in the United States is 51.8%. Emergency Department (ED) based influenza programs have been successfully implemented and improve vaccine uptake, reduce incidence and costs, as well as improve outcomes. We modeled the process of implementing an ED based vaccination program for a large health system’s Medicare (65+) and Medicaid populations. We utilized existing electronic health records (EHR) and evaluated the impact on the patient population and expenditures to health system.
